
Chip Roy
Conservative
Republican
House Representative
Texas - District 21
Current Position: US House Representative TX-21
Policy Positions
Economic Policy
- For delegating Medicare to states and requiring balanced budget amendment before passing new legislation
Health Care
- Against healthcare mandates and vaccine requirements; supports healthcare freedom and choice
Education
- Against Critical Race Theory, radical gender theory, and 'woke' ideology in schools
Environment
- For questioning scientific consensus on climate change attributing it to human activity
Civil Rights
- Against abortion rights; supports pro-life positions and defends those prosecuted under the FACE Act for praying at abortion clinics
- Against second impeachment of Donald Trump despite calling his conduct 'clearly impeachable'
Voting Rights & Democracy
- For securing the border and designating cartels as Foreign Terrorist Organizations
- For election security measures including the SAVE Act to ensure only American citizens vote in federal elections
- Against Trump's false claims of 2020 election fraud; opposed efforts to overturn election results and voted to certify electoral votes
Immigration & Foreign Affairs
- Against NATO withdrawal restrictions; voted against preventing Trump from withdrawing from NATO without Congress consent
- Against special immigrant visas for Afghan allies; voted against the ALLIES Act
Public Safety
- For backing law enforcement and against defunding police; supports putting criminals behind bars
- For Second Amendment rights and against red flag laws
- Against federal disaster relief spending that adds to national debt without border security funding
